Chapter 315: Map and sand table

The delineated battlefield is fairly broad, but overall, the terrain is not complicated, and apart from two hills with a little height, there is almost nothing worth mentioning. Cheng Chumo and Qin Huaiyu chose to station the camp at the foot of one of the mountains called Xiaoniu Mountain. It's close to a stream and easy to get water, but it's a good choice.

Li Xin inspected the camp and found that everyone was strictly following the usual practice. The camp was in order, and it felt pretty good.

Back in the main general’s camp, Li Xin found that it was a bit lively. Several people, including Cheng Chumo, Qin Huaiyu, Niu Jianhu, Yuchi Baolin and others, gathered around the big table in the center of the camp to discuss something enthusiastically.

When Li Xin came in, everyone looked up. Niu Jianhu was very excited and said, "His Royal Highness, you have done a great job with this sand table!"

Yuchi Baolin was holding a map and shouted, "With this map, it's like putting the battlefield in front of you."

Li Xin smiled, motioned everyone to move away from a position, and then sat down and said, "No way. After all, I can only work on these places."

After speaking, his eyes fell on the table in front of him.

This is not an ordinary table. If you have to say it, it should be more like a large square basin with four legs, and both length and width are five feet. The basin is covered with fine sand and gravel, carefully piled into high and low shapes. If you look at the two highest ridges intently, it is not difficult to find that one of them is somewhat similar to Xiaoniu Mountain. The other uplift naturally represents another mountain in the simulated battlefield, Wuyun Mountain.

That's right, this is the simulated sand table carefully made by Li Xin.

The simulated battlefield was not temporarily delineated. As early as the day before the military exercise, Li Shimin sent a map of the battlefield to Li Xin's hands. After Li Xin opened the map, he just glanced at it and wanted to tear up the so-called map, which was inferior to papyrus, and rushed into the toilet.. Well, there is no toilet at the moment. It won't be found in any corner of the earth. It can only be thrown into the cesspool.

The function of a map is to tell the reader important geographic information. The map sent by Li Shimin contained almost nothing except simple lines and text. In any case, as a map, should there be a scale?

Looking at Li Xin who was almost vomiting blood, Wang Gui leaned over and took a look.

"Is this the military map you used?" Li Xin asked helplessly.

Wang Gui nodded, and didn't seem to think there was anything wrong with this map.

Li Xin shook his head and asked vigorously, "It's nothing more, let me ask you, are you familiar with this place?"

"Yeah. Guanzhong is nothing I'm not familiar with." Wang Gui said confidently. As a king of scouts, he knows the terrain of most places in the pass.

Therefore, Li Xin re-drew a map overnight on the basis of the original map, adding a series of information such as scale, height information, route, topography and so on. Of course, this information is based on Wang Gui's information source.

This is also the reason why Li Xin was so tired as soon as he returned to the palace.

Since this map can now be recognized by Cheng Chumo and others, it proves that Wang Gui is really not a big talker.

As for the sand table that matches the map, Li Xin ordered Wang Guidui just now. Speaking of which, Wang Gui is really very spiritual about these military matters. Li Xin simply explained the essentials, and he could do things beautifully. For example, the sand table in front of me was almost exactly the same as Li Xin had imagined.

After the sand table and map were prepared, Li Xin called Cheng Chumo and the others into his camp, and then took advantage of the two things they studied, and went out to the camp for a round.

Now that these two things can be recognized by everyone, he certainly has a sense of accomplishment.

"Now everyone should understand the terrain of this decisive battle. What do you think?" Li Xin asked with a smile.

He had already thought about it. Although he knows how to train and some basic common sense in military affairs, when the two armies are really going to confront each other, he really doesn't know what to do or where to start. Therefore, he decided to make good use of these people in front of him, including Cheng Chumo and Qin Huaiyu.

I said it a long time ago. Although these two people are usually not very bright, they are also the biological sons of the famous Datang generals Cheng Yaojin and Qin Qiong behind the gate. As the saying goes, tiger fathers have no dogs, and they usually know about war at home, and they must have a much deeper understanding of war than Li Xin. After all, even though Li Xin said he was behind the generals, the Li Xuandao who could be called the **** of war had long since been alive, and he hadn't taught anything.

The same goes for Niu Jianhu and Yuchi Baolin. Niu Jinda, Yu Chigong...Which one did not make any contribution to Datang? A few of them... their sons get together to fight a decent battle. It shouldn't be a big problem, right?
